What to Fix Before Approving Mint Ice
When we write a mint ice specification with a distributor, we fix four things first: the resistance band, the liquid capacity tolerance, the puff count methodology and the packaging master carton. Everything else can flex without changing the customer experience.
Specification sheets are where a mint ice deal is won or quietly lost. Two samples can look and taste the same while using different coil wire, different wicking density and different tolerances on the mouthpiece. Those details decide how the unit behaves in week three rather than minute three.
| Product category | Closed pod |
|---|---|
| Resistance band | 1.2 - 1.4 ohm |
| Capacity tolerance | +/- 5% |
| Puff count method | Machine cycle 3s on / 27s off |
| Master carton | 240 units |
| Carton weight | 6.5 kg |
| Shelf life | 24 months |
| Storage | 15-25 C, dry, away from direct light |

How Mint Ice Batches Are Checked
AQL sampling gets a lot of attention, but for mint ice the more useful habit is simply measuring the same three things on every single batch. Trend lines catch problems that pass/fail checks miss.
The cheapest quality control step is a retained sample. Keeping three sealed units from every mint ice batch costs almost nothing and turns any dispute into a simple comparison instead of an argument over photographs.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I mix strengths in one order?
In most cases yes, as long as each strength meets the minimum run length. Mixed strength cartons are popular with retailers building their first display because they show the full ladder without over committing.
Can I visit the production facility?
Yes, and we encourage it for larger programmes. Visits are most useful when you already have a draft specification, because you can then check the specific processes behind the numbers you care about.
What if I only need a small first order?
That is normal and sensible. A mixed carton lets you test mint ice in your own market before committing to a production run, and the specification you approve at that stage carries through to larger orders unchanged.
How long does a mint ice order take to arrive?
Production typically takes ten to eighteen working days after artwork approval, and transit depends on the method you choose. Air express is fastest, sea freight is cheapest at volume. We confirm both at quotation so there is no surprise later.
